0.08$/install with facebook is very good. the question is how many people leave your app installed.
try to make your campaign more aggressive and get 1000 installs per week. this will confuse google play algorithm and put your app in the top of the list and that will bring you free installs. it is not cheap to market your app. i spent until today more then 1000$ on app marketing and still did not get the result i wanted (even not near to what i wanted)
what i used for marketing is: facebook, google adsense, youtube videos by youtubers with lot of subscribers, forums, friends/family, printed flyers and more.

Hi everyone.

I don't often post in the forum, but let's share my experience.
Monthly Download:
1st month 100 downloads (my friends)
2nd month 800
3rd month 3000
... 7 month 9000
without $ marketing investment.

I first asked my friends to download the app and give it a rating. User rating and responses to reviews (with app name keywords, etc.) are essential.
It is also important that the application with the same "id" is published in other stores (Amazon, Huawei ...)

This is my experience with 2 apps.


One application with a total download of about 10,000 is on google top charts.
The other one with over 40,000 downloads is not listed, but in the google play stors search engine it ranks among the top 5
